    The SAP error message /SAPSLL/PRCLS_API206 Enter the control class typically occurs in the context of SAP Global Trade Services (GTS) or SAP Logistics, particularly when dealing with customs and compliance processes. This error indicates that a required field, specifically the "control class," has not been filled in or is missing in the relevant transaction or process.
    
    Cause: Missing Input: The control class field is mandatory for the transaction you are trying to execute, and it has not been filled in.
    Configuration Issues: There may be a configuration issue in the system where the control class is not properly defined or linked to the relevant processes. User Input Error: The user may have overlooked entering the control class due to oversight or misunderstanding of the required fields.
